COW PUJAN





  • Gopashtami is a festival that commemorates the day Lord Sri Krishana ji was promoted to cowherd from a herder of calves.  On the anniversary of this day, which usually falls in November, herders bring hundreds of cows and their calves to Brij Dham from nearby barns.


  • The cows are beautifully decorated for the occasion: they are painted, their horns are gilded, and they wear ankle bracelets and splendid peacock-feather crowns. As the herders drive the animals through the narrow streets of Brij Dham, men and boys tease and harry them in a riotous rite called "cow play."  Finally the cows are driven to Govardhan Puja Courtyard where they are rewarded with a feast of sweet dishes specially prepared for them.
